Results for Takeaway In Spanish Translation

Loading Results
Related Searches
takeaway in spanish translation
take away in spanish
take away meaning in spanish
takeaway meaning in english
what does takeaway mean in english
take away food in spanish
meaning of takeaways in english
takeaway meaning in french
takeaways meaning in tagalog
what is the meaning of takeaway
Loading Additional Information